The Sanctuary of Las Lajas (in full Sanctuary of Our Lady of the Holy Rosary of Las Lajas) is a Catholic minor basilica located within the canyon of the Guáitara River in Ipiales, Nariño Department, Colombia. The Marian shrine is dedicated to the Blessed Virgin Mary as Our Lady of the Rosary.

Pious believers claim that the colorful Madonna and Child image displayed on the rock wall is of divine origin, and that it was formed without human intervention. The current church was built in a neo-gothic architectural style between 1916 and 1949. The name Laja is Spanish for a flagstone, and comes from the name of a type of flat sedimentary rock.

Pope Pius XII granted a Pontifical Decree of coronation to the image as Sancta Virgo de Rupe (English: Holy Virgin of the Rock) on 31 May 1951. He also raised the Marian shrine to the status of a Minor basilica via his decree Templum per Decorum on 30 August 1954. Pope Paul VI granted the Marian title as the Virgin of the Holy Rosary as the Patroness of Ipiales via his decree Tutela Cælestis Virtutis on 26 April 1965.

It is a popular pilgrimage site for Christians from both Colombia and neighboring Ecuador, due to a Marian apparition that is purported to have taken place here in the 18th century.
